Joseph Wright submitted the
tex-ini-files
package.
Version number: 2016-02-27
License type: pd
Summary description: Model TeX format creation files
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
tex-ini-files
=============
This bundle provides a collection of model .ini files for creating TeX
formats. These files are commonly used to introduced
distribution-dependent variations in formats. They are also used to
allow existing …
[View More]format source files to be used with newer engines, for
example to adapt the plain e-TeX source file to work with XeTeX and
LuaTeX.

Alexander Grahn submitted the
xsavebox
package.
Version number: 0.1 2016-02-13
License type: lppl1.3
Summary description: Saveboxes for repeating content without code
replication, based on PDF Form XObjects
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
This package defines commands for saving content that can be repeatedly
placed into the document without replicating DVI/PDF code in the output
file, allowing for smaller file size …
[View More]of the final PDF and improved
content caching for faster display in certain PDF viewers. The method
makes use of `Form XObjects' defined in the PDF specification.
The user commands are modelled after the standard LaTeX commands
savebox, sbox, usebox and the `lrbox' environment.
All common TeX engines and back-ends are supported:
* pdfLaTeX, LuaLaTeX
* LaTeX --> dvips --> ps2pdf/Distiller
* (Xe)LaTeX --> (x)dvipdfmx
The user commands are:
* content saving:
xsavebox{<name>}[<width>][<position>]{...}
xsavebox*{<name>}[<width>][<position>]{...}
xsbox{<name>}{...}
egin{xlrbox}{<name>}...end{xlrbox}
egin{xlrbox*}{<name>}...end{xlrbox*}
<name> is an identifier (not a command!) composed of arbitrary
non-active characters, including spaces and numbers. A command for
declaration of <name> does not exist.
Starred `*' variants allow for colour injection (pdfLaTeX/LuaLaTeX
only).
* content insertion (referencing):
xusebox{<name>}
he<name>
The second, short form is useable if <name> is composed of
[a-zA-Z].
The package was written in the LaTeX3 syntax.
